What is the structure of the judicial system in El Salvador?

The judicial system of El Salvador is made up of several levels, including the Supreme Court of Justice, the Courts of Appeals, the Trial Courts and the Peace Courts. The Supreme Court is the highest judicial authority and oversees the administration of justice in the country.

What is the role of international cooperation in the recovery of assets from money laundering in Guatemala?

International cooperation plays a crucial role in the recovery of assets from money laundering in Guatemala. Through cooperation agreements and treaties, the exchange of information, technical and legal assistance, and collaboration in investigations and judicial processes are facilitated to identify, track and recover assets resulting from money laundering. International cooperation can also help strengthen asset confiscation and repatriation systems.

What is the role of tax incentives in promoting entrepreneurship in Bolivia?

Tax incentives can play an important role in promoting entrepreneurship in Bolivia by providing financial stimuli and reducing barriers to the creation and growth of new businesses. Tax incentives may include tax deductions for expenses related to starting a business, tax exemptions for income generated by business activities, tax credits for investments in business capital, or reductions in tax rates for startup companies. These tax incentives can make entrepreneurship more attractive and accessible to entrepreneurs by reducing the tax costs associated with establishing and operating a business. In addition, specific tax incentives for strategic sectors or priority regions can encourage business creation in areas where economic growth and job creation need to be stimulated. On the other hand, a negative fiscal record, such as high corporate tax rates or an excessive tax burden on entrepreneurs, can discourage business activity and limit entrepreneurship in Bolivia. Therefore, it is important for tax authorities in Bolivia to design tax policies that support entrepreneurship and promote a favorable business environment for the creation and growth of innovative and competitive companies.
